No-Bake Strawberry Twinkie Cake
A creamy, fruity dessert made with soft cake rolls, whipped filling, and fresh strawberries—no oven needed.
🧾 Ingredients
- 8–10 Twinkie (or any cream-filled sponge cakes)
- 2 cups whipped cream (or whipped topping)
- 1 cup cream cheese (softened)
- 2–3 tbsp powdered sugar (to taste)
- 1 tsp vanilla extract
- 1–2 cups sliced strawberry
- Optional: strawberry jam or syrup for extra flavor
🔥 Instructions
1. Prepare the cream filling
In a bowl, mix:
- cream cheese
- powdered sugar
- vanilla
Fold in whipped cream until light and fluffy.
2. Slice the Twinkies
- Cut Twinkies lengthwise or into chunks
- Arrange a layer in a dish or tray
3. Build the cake layers
- Spread a layer of cream mixture
- Add sliced strawberries
- Repeat layers until ingredients are used
4. Chill
- Cover and refrigerate for 4–6 hours (or overnight)
👉 This helps everything soften and blend together.
5. Serve
- Slice and serve cold
- Top with extra strawberries or syrup if desired

⭐ Tips for best results
- Use ripe strawberries for best flavor
- Chill overnight for a cake-like texture
- Add a thin layer of jam for extra sweetness
- For firmer slices, reduce whipped cream slightly
